Newcastle Jets vs Auckland FC Preview & Tips
The Newcastle Jets could move seven points clear at the summit of the A-League if they can defeat Auckland FC at the weekend.
Auckland FC know how important a win is this weekend, with the side able to move to within a point of the leaders with victory.
- The Jets have won their last four home games
- Both sides have scored in the last three meetings between the clubs
Head To Head
The Jets have won two of the four meetings between the sides including the last two matches. Meanwhile, Auckland have won once with one game ending as a draw.
Newcastle Jets Form
The Newcastle Jets continued their stunning run of form in the A-League with yet another win as they downed WS Wanderers 2-1 in their last outing.
This win extended their unbeaten run to 11 matches, while it ensured they bounced back from a disappointing 0-0 draw with the Central Coast Mariners. With the exception of their draw with Central Coast, the Jets have won their last 10 in a dominant run of form.
The form of the leaders has clearly woken Auckland FC up, with their opponents misfiring prior to a five-game unbeaten run. With a draw or victory in this mouth-watering fixture one that the Jets will know benefits them, I predict that the home side will go all out for the latter. Another win will send them seven points clear at the summit, and I predict they will notch their seventh win in 11 home games.
Auckland FC Form
Auckland FC were denied a third consecutive win in the A-League by Perth Glory last week as their struggling opponents secured a battling draw.
Dropping two points means Auckland slipped four points short of the leaders meaning they are unable to move above their opponents with a win. Despite this, Auckland’s need for a win is huge. Not only would it drag them to within a point, but it would also extend their own unbeaten run to six matches whilst ending the Jets’ run.
The travelling side have managed to breach the defence of their opponents in their last three meetings and I back them to extend this run to four games, but I do not back them to win this match. The Jets have been outstanding of late and will likely extend their winning run against the Kiwi side to three matches.
Verdict
I am backing the Jets to secure three crucial points despite failing to keep a clean sheet for the fourth consecutive time against their opponents.
